What to Expect from the Cafe Jaguar Cooking Class

When you arrive at Cafe Jaguar in Costa Maya, you’ll find a welcoming space just a short ride from your cruise ship. The vibe is casual and friendly, with a lively bar area where you can start by ordering your included drink—whether that’s a fresh cocktail, mocktail, or something sweet from their extensive menu. The setting offers stunning beach views, making every moment more enjoyable.
Once everyone’s settled, the cooking begins. The chefs and crew are knowledgeable and eager to share their tips, making sure you learn a few tricks along the way. The highlight of the class is making tortillas from scratch—using a dough, a tortilla press, and cooking on an authentic comal. It’s a simple process but makes a big difference in flavor and texture compared to store-bought versions. Watching those tortillas puff up on the heat is satisfying, and you’ll get to sample your handiwork warm.
Along With tortillas, you’ll marinate pork—perfect for tacos al pastor—and whip up fresh salsas and guacamole. The process is interactive and relaxed, giving everyone a chance to participate at their comfort level. The tasting part is a real treat. You get to enjoy your homemade tacos alongside snacks, sampling the flavors that make Mexican cuisine so vibrant. Plus, the tequila tasting adds a festive touch, whether you prefer sipping on a neat shot or enjoying it in a cocktail.
Throughout the session, the guide provides helpful tips that make the preparation accessible, even if you’re new to cooking. We loved the way they balanced education with fun, making sure everyone left with a better understanding of Mexican flavors. The Food, Drinks, and Atmosphere
The lunch featuring pastor pork tacos with handmade tortillas is obviously the star of the show. The tortillas are fresh and warm, making the tacos taste authentic and satisfying. The guacamole and pico de gallo are simple but flavorful, adding the perfect touches to your tacos. It’s a generous enough meal to leave you full but not weighed down, ideal if you plan to continue sightseeing or relaxing afterward.
The beverage selection is impressive. From refreshing mocktails and artisan sodas to frosty margaritas and daiquiris, you'll find something to suit your mood. During the reviews, travelers appreciated the variety—“I loved the fresh margaritas, and the mocktail was perfect for a daytime activity.” The tequila sampling is a bonus for those interested in the local spirit, offering a taste of Mexico beyond the usual.
The setting itself is a highlight. Facing the beach, the cafe provides beautiful views of the Caribbean, which makes even a quick bite or break feel special. The relaxed vibe encourages socializing and enjoying your drinks while watching the waves roll in, making it more than just a cooking class—it's a mini escape.
Practical Details and Tips

Transportation is straightforward—your taxi driver will drop you off at the cafe, and you’ll pay them directly (around $5 USD each way). This gives you flexibility to arrive early or linger afterward, whether to swim, shop, or just soak up the sun.
The tour duration of about 2 hours makes it perfect for fitting into a cruise port day without feeling rushed. The small group size (maximum 16 travelers) ensures an intimate experience, where everyone can participate and ask questions comfortably.
The inclusion of free high-speed internet and lockers is thoughtful, especially if you want to check your messages or secure your belongings while enjoying the beach. The tour is family-friendly, provided children are comfortable in a casual group setting—though it’s mostly geared toward adults or older kids interested in cooking or cultural experiences.
Pricing at $63.20 per person is reasonable, considering the food, drinks, and hands-on activity. It’s a good value if you want more than just a sightseeing stop—this is an engaging, flavorful way to learn about Mexican cuisine.

FAQs

Is this tour suitable for children?
While generally geared toward adults, children who enjoy cooking or are comfortable in a relaxed group setting might enjoy it. The experience is casual and family-friendly but primarily focused on fun and learning.
How long does the tour last?
About 2 hours, making it a manageable activity during a cruise port day.
What is included in the price?
You get a hands-on cooking class, a lunch of pastor pork tacos with handmade tortillas, your choice of a drink from a large menu, bottled water, access to lockers, and free high-speed internet.
Do I need to arrange my transportation?
Yes, you'll need to take a taxi (around $5 USD per person each way). The tour is located just five minutes from the cruise port, so it’s quick and easy.
Can I stay after the class to enjoy the beach?
Absolutely. You can use the lockers to store your belongings and then go for a swim or explore the downtown beach and shopping area.
Are tips included?
No, gratuities are not included but are appreciated if you feel the staff provided excellent service.
What is the best time to book?
Most travelers book about 52 days in advance, which suggests it’s popular but not overly booked.
Is there a dress code?
Casual, comfortable clothing suitable for cooking and possibly getting a little messy.
Can I cancel if I change my mind?
Yes, cancellations are free if made at least 24 hours in advance.
